STARKVILLE Paul W. Bannister, Sr., age 72 of State Highway 80 passed away peacefully on Sunday Morning, November 5, 2017 in Little Falls Hospital. He had the comfort of his loving family at his side.
He was born December 14, 1944 in Batavia a son of the late Leland and Lola Suttell Bannister, he was raised and educated in the Batavia area. In 1962 Paul joined the United States Navy, he was stationed on the USS Mountrail. He attended Mohawk Valley Community College and Moody Bible Institute obtaining Associates Degrees at both schools. On April 7, 1981 he married the former Sally A. Fitzgerald in Tolland, Connecticut. In 1982 they moved to Starkville. Paul was a Mason by trade and worked for Union Local No. 2 in Albany. Later in his career Paul worked with his Ministry, counseling at The Utica Rescue Mission, doing what he did best helping others.
In his spare time Paul enjoyed his Chevy Corvette and most of all being with his family. He was a friend to many will never be forgotten.
